#36940d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#36940d is composed of 21.2% red, 58% green and 5.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 63.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 91.2% yellow and 42% black. It has a hue angle of 101.8 degrees, a saturation of 83.9% and a lightness of 31.6%. #36940d color hex could be obtained by blending #6cff1a with #002900. Closest websafe color is: #339900.

#36940d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#36940d has RGB values of R:54, G:148, B:13 and CMYK values of C:0.64, M:0, Y:0.91, K:0.42. Its decimal value is 3576845.

Shades and Tints of #36940d

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010400 is the darkest color, while #f5fef1 is the lightest one.

Tones of #36940d

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#4e564b is the less saturated color, while #31a001 is the most saturated one.
